I was raised in middle Tennessee, and my family, at least four generations that I know of, always considered having blackeyed peas, greens, pork, and cornbread on New Years day the meal for good luck the following year. I have lived here in California for 43 years, but I always continue this tradition,,,,,,, and I consider myself and my family very lucky.
